Understanding Thyroid Disorders Before They Affect Your Health
The thyroid gland is a small butterfly-shaped gland located in the front of your neck. Although small in size, it plays a major role in controlling metabolism, energy levels, heart function, body temperature, and hormonal balance.
Unfortunately, many people ignore the early symptoms of thyroid disorders, assuming they are simply signs of stress, aging, or fatigue. Early diagnosis through a thyroid profile test can help prevent serious health complications.

What Does the Thyroid Gland Do?
The thyroid gland produces hormones that regulate several important body functions.
Main Thyroid Hormones
| Hormone | Function |
|---|---|
| T3 (Triiodothyronine) | Controls metabolism and energy production |
| T4 (Thyroxine) | Supports growth and development |
| TSH (Thyroid Stimulating Hormone) | Regulates thyroid hormone production |
When these hormone levels become unbalanced, thyroid disorders may occur.
1. Unexplained Weight Gain
One of the most common symptoms of hypothyroidism is sudden weight gain.
Even if you are eating normally and exercising regularly, a slow thyroid can reduce metabolism and cause weight increase.
Common Signs
✔ Increased body weight
✔ Difficulty losing weight
✔ Feeling sluggish throughout the day
2. Constant Fatigue and Low Energy
Do you feel tired even after a full night’s sleep?
Low thyroid hormone levels can affect energy production and cause:
- Persistent tiredness
- Lack of motivation
- Reduced productivity
- Weakness
Fatigue is often one of the earliest warning signs of thyroid dysfunction.
3. Hair Fall and Thinning Hair
Excessive hair loss can indicate thyroid hormone imbalance.
Symptoms Include
- Hair thinning
- Dry hair
- Slow hair growth
- Excessive shedding
Proper thyroid treatment often helps improve hair health.
4. Mood Swings and Depression
Thyroid hormones influence brain function and emotional well-being.
People with thyroid disorders may experience:
- Anxiety
- Depression
- Irritability
- Difficulty concentrating
Hormonal imbalance can directly affect mental health.
5. Dry Skin and Brittle Nails
If your skin becomes unusually dry despite proper hydration, your thyroid may be the reason.
Common Symptoms
- Rough skin
- Cracked heels
- Brittle nails
- Reduced sweating
These symptoms are frequently associated with hypothyroidism.
6. Irregular Menstrual Cycles
Women with thyroid disorders often experience menstrual irregularities.
Possible Changes
- Heavy periods
- Missed periods
- Fertility issues
- Hormonal imbalance
Regular thyroid screening is especially important for women.
7. Increased Sensitivity to Cold
Do you feel colder than everyone around you?
An underactive thyroid slows metabolism, making it difficult for the body to generate sufficient heat.
Symptoms
✔ Cold hands and feet
✔ Chills
✔ Intolerance to cold weather
8. Fast or Slow Heart Rate
The thyroid gland directly affects heart function.
Hypothyroidism
- Slow heartbeat
- Low energy
- Fatigue
Hyperthyroidism
- Rapid heartbeat
- Palpitations
- Increased sweating
Doctors often recommend ECG testing along with thyroid evaluation in some cases.
9. Difficulty Concentrating
Many thyroid patients experience “brain fog.”
Symptoms Include
- Poor concentration
- Memory issues
- Slow thinking
- Difficulty focusing
Early thyroid treatment can help improve cognitive function.
10. Swelling Around the Neck
An enlarged thyroid gland, also known as a goiter, may cause visible swelling in the neck.
Warning Signs
- Neck fullness
- Difficulty swallowing
- Throat discomfort
- Visible swelling
Medical evaluation is recommended immediately if these symptoms occur.
Who Is at Higher Risk of Thyroid Disorders?
You may be at higher risk if you:
- Are above 30 years old
- Have a family history of thyroid disease
- Are diabetic
- Have hormonal imbalance
- Are pregnant or recently delivered a baby
- Are a woman over 40
Regular thyroid screening can help identify problems before symptoms worsen.
